Hi,

I've noticed that, in GuixSD, if one rolls back the system with 'guix
system roll-back' or switches to a previous generation with 'guix system
switch-generation', and then one tries to run 'guix system reconfigure',
the operation fails because the symlink for the new generation already
exists.  I expected the operation to succeed and overwrite the existing
generation, since that mirrors the behavior of 'guix package'.

Specifically, if the current generation is N and generation N+1 exists,
then running 'guix system reconfigure' should overwrite generation N+1
with the new system.  Currently, it fails to create the symlink.  I've
attached a patch which modifies the behavior to be what I expected.
